(Upsit,) Wpseat, n. [Sete n. or Sit n.] = Upsitting vbl. n. 2. — 1626 Aberd. B. Rec. III 9.
Nather yit shall thair be any mair persones invited to any denner, supper, or afternoones drink at a baptime … dureing the haill space of the womanes chyldbed, or at the wpseat, bot sex men and sex wemen at the most
